Zach and Miri let it all hang out in new comedy

By Faheem Ahmed     10/30/08 7:00pm

Kevin Smith, director of cult classics like Clerks, Mall Rats and Chasing Amy, is notorious for his love of filthy dialogue, filthy sex and poignant romances . er, filthy poignant romances. His new comedy, Zack and Miri Make a Porno, contains all of the above and then some.As a thriving industry earning billions of dollars each year, pornography has played a large role in determining which forms of video technology will become popular. Mainstream porn picked VHS tapes to replace Beta, DVD to replace VHS and has just chosen Blu-ray to overtake HD.

With the growth and prevalence of the Internet, the porn industry has exploded. Reality and amateur porn are now so popular that anyone with a camera and a laptop can make a profit. When Zack (Pineapple Express' Seth Rogen) and Miri (The 40-Year-Old Virgin's Elizabeth Banks) can no longer pay their water or electricity bills, they do exactly that.

Rogen and Banks play lifelong friends and roommates in a classic case of two underachievers who have spent their whole lives working at the same coffee shop. After attending their 10-year high school reunion, they realize they have done nothing substantive with their lives.



Rogen proposes to make a porno, and Banks reluctantly jumps on board the production of Star Whores (a revision of the George Lucas classic, complete with light-dildos). They recruit Delaney, played by Craig Robinson (Darryl in "The Office"), to produce, Lester, played by Jason Mewes (Clerks's Jay) to be the lead male and Deacon, played by Jeff Anderson (Clerks's Randal), to film the amateur project.

The movie also features hilarious cameos: Justin Long (Dodgeball)drops some hilarious lines as a gay porn star at the high school reunion, and Traci Lords, made famous for her real-life career as an underage porn actress, has a unique talent better left undescribed.

I was definitely curious to see how the comedy team of Rogen, Banks and Robinson would mesh with Kevin Smith's crew of Mewes and Anderson, and while the result was a bit uneven, it was still hilarious. As usual, Rogen plays the fat, average underachiever who has loads of potential but does not know how to use it. His one-liners and delivery of long, detailed sex descriptions are spot-on. Banks also holds her own as Miri, an honest girl with low self-esteem and an infectious laugh.

The platonic relationship between the two roommates is convincing. Viewers will have a tough time finding the chemistry, though, when Rogen and Banks start realizing they love each other. Instead of making a love story with a porno, Smith seems to have attempted a porno with a love story, and the two don't mix very well. Love between two best friends is contrived; having them fall in love while making a porno is a bit more original, but Smith does not devote any time to developing this on-screen. Plus, gorgeous Miri would never fall for oafish Zack in real life (but hey, that's what movies are for).

Robinson plays Delaney, Rogen's best friend and financier of Star Whores. He infuses Delaney with such subtlety that it perfectly complements Rogen's outspoken performance.

A Zack and Miri audience should expect mixed reactions, as they'll find themselves exploding with laughter, groaning in disgust and laughing while groaning in disgust. Smith never holds anything back, to the regret of the MPAA, and delivers a comedy for a slightly older audience. Despite the slowness of the last 15 minutes and the forced love story, I recommend taking a loved one or a best friend you're secretly in love with to this movie in hopes of inspiration.
